Phone number ☎️ 01313811738 👆 is reported as a persistent nuisance scam primarily operating under the guise of well-known mobile providers such as Vodafone, O2, EE, and 3, as well as supposed finance and accident claim companies. Callers frequently claim to offer upgrades, discounts, or resolve account issues but request personal information or confirmation by voice, potentially to facilitate fraudulent activity. Many victims note vague, hesitant, or evasive responses when questioned, and calls often stem from different numbers. Calls persist despite attempts to register on the Telephone Preference Service, indicating non-compliance with regulations. Recipients are advised not to engage, never to share personal details, and to block the number immediately to avoid potential identity theft or financial fraud.

About 01 Numbers
These numbers correspond to specific locations in the UK and are widely used by domestic and commercial premises. Also known as as 'basic rate', 'local rate', or 'national rate' numbers, the costs for these geographic numbers are contingent on the time of day. Numerous service providers offer call packages that grant free calls during specified times. Call costs from mobile phones are dependent on the chosen calling plan, with various plans offering these numbers in their free call packages.
